LeakWatch

Secret scanning from the outside, no install, no access

What it does

LeakWatch finds the API keys you leaked in public commits and in your repositories, then tests each one against its provider : so you know which are still live, not just which matched a pattern. Free lookup by username, continuous monitoring for your repos, and a REST API for the rest.

LeakWatch scans public GitHub, GitLab and Codeberg for leaked secrets, checks the JavaScript bundles and config your site actually serves, and flags any key exposed on both sides.

Free plan — one deep scan every 30 days. Paid plans — unlimited deep scans, plus continuous monitoring of new commits. A regex tells you a string looks like a key. Everything below is what turns that guess into something you can act on. Every match gets one read-only call to the provider. A key that still answers is an incident, not a pattern hit. Bundles, source maps, exposed .env and .git . A key in both your history and your live site was never rotated. Public pushes on GitHub, GitLab and Codeberg are read within seconds — not on a nightly sweep.
